Overview

The Citizen Miyano BNE-65MYY is a dual-spindle, twin-turret CNC turning center with dual Y-axis, enhanced milling, and 65mm bar capacity, the largest BNE-MYY.

Main spindle: 5,000 RPM, 18.5/15 kW. Sub-spindle: 11/7.5 kW at 5,000 RPM. Both turrets carry 12 stations with 24 live tools at 6,000 RPM. Dual Y-axis for off-center machining on both ends.

Rapid traverse: 20/18/12 m/min. Max machining length: 195mm. At 8,130 kg, same 2,860 x 2,190mm footprint as 51mm MYY. 47 kVA.

Addresses demand for complete part machining at 65mm bar with full off-center capability on both ends. Automotive, hydraulic, oil and gas, and industrial manufacturers in the 51-65mm range.
